Hotel Accounts Management and Cost Accounting System


Summary

The British Academy for Training and Development presents this training course in (Hotel Accounts Management and Cost Accounting System) to all professionals wishing to understand the latest accounting systems in tourism establishments, by understanding all professional aspects, beside effective and modern methods to generate accurate accounting results. Having a profitable tourism establishment is not a simple mission, and one of the most significant conditions for success in tourism sector, is the presence of professional accountant able to manage the accounts of the business, through a solid accounting system.

Hotel accounting is no longer as simple as it used to be, since it requires major focus on financial transactions of the hotel, beside the accounts Income and Expenditure, Taxes, Credit and Debit accounts over a certain period of time. How will trainees benefit from the Course?

After completing the program, trainees will be able to master the following topics:

  • Methods of Financial Performance Accounting for enterprises, according to globally certified accounting system.
  • Supervision & Reporting Methods on all hotel sections, and preparation of a daily overview of workflow mechanisms.
  • Proper ways to deal with complaints that may be raised by hotel guests.
  • Reconcile and maintain balance sheet accounts and general ledger operations.
  • Prepare journal entries and assist with monthly closings and preparation of financial statements.
  • Preparation of monthly financial reports.
  • Management of accounts receivable and accounts payable
  • Tax computations and returns.

Course Content

  • Payroll administration, and implementing and maintaining internal financial controls and procedures.
  • Definition and Concepts of Cost Accounting System in Tourism Establishments.
  • Methods of Accounting System Management.
  • Development Strategies of accounting systems.
  • Understanding the mechanisms of financial transactions conducted within the company.
  • Budget control, and Preparation of financial accounts and statements;
  • The major global accounting systems and methods.
  • Receipt and crediting of payments and remittances.
  • Writing financial reports related to the financial statements of the company, for a certain period of time.
  • Collecting entitlements of all employees, according to the approved payroll, wages, and incentives spent during the month.
  • Rendering of periodic financial statements to Manager and Board Officers.
  • How to discover and adjust any fake expenses on and control all financial transactions.
